package com.orientechnologies.orient.server.distributed.asynch;
import com.orientechnologies.common.concur.ONeedRetryException;
import com.orientechnologies.orient.core.replication.OAsyncReplicationError;
import com.orientechnologies.orient.core.sql.OCommandSQL;
import com.orientechnologies.orient.server.distributed.AbstractServerClusterTest;
import com.orientechnologies.orient.server.distributed.ServerRun;
import com.tinkerpop.blueprints.Direction;
import com.tinkerpop.blueprints.Edge;
import com.tinkerpop.blueprints.impls.orient.OrientGraphFactory;
import com.tinkerpop.blueprints.impls.orient.OrientGraphNoTx;
import com.tinkerpop.blueprints.impls.orient.OrientVertex;
import junit.framework.Assert;
import org.junit.Test;
/**
* Check vertex and edge creation are propagated across all the nodes in asynchronous mode.
*/
public class ServerClusterAsyncGraphTest extends AbstractServerClusterTest {
final static int SERVERS = 2;
private OrientVertex v1;
private OrientVertex v2;
private OrientVertex v3;
public String getDatabaseName() {
return "distributed-graphtest";
}
@Test
public void test() throws Exception {
init(SERVERS);
prepare(false);
execute();
}
@Override
protected String getDistributedServerConfiguration(final ServerRun server) {
return "asynch-dserver-config-" + server.getServerId() + ".xml";
}
@Override
protected void executeTest() throws Exception {
{
OrientGraphFactory factory = new OrientGraphFactory("plocal:target/server0/databases/" + getDatabaseName());
OrientGraphNoTx g = factory.getNoTx();
try {
g.createVertexType("Post");
g.createVertexType("User");
g.createEdgeType("Own");
g.addVertex("class:User");
g.command(new OCommandSQL("insert into Post (content, timestamp) values('test', 1)")).execute();
} finally {
g.shutdown();
}
}
// CHECK VERTEX CREATION ON ALL THE SERVERS
for (int s = 0; s<SERVERS; ++s) {
OrientGraphFactory factory2 = new OrientGraphFactory("plocal:target/server" + s + "/databases/" + getDatabaseName());
OrientGraphNoTx g2 = factory2.getNoTx();
try {
Iterable<OrientVertex> result = g2.command(new OCommandSQL("select from Post")).execute();
Assert.assertTrue(result.iterator().hasNext());
Assert.assertNotNull(result.iterator().next());
} finally {
g2.shutdown();
}
}
{
OrientGraphFactory factory = new OrientGraphFactory("plocal:target/server0/databases/" + getDatabaseName());
OrientGraphNoTx g = factory.getNoTx();
try {
g.command(new OCommandSQL("create edge Own from (select from User) to (select from Post)").onAsyncReplicationError(new OAsyncReplicationError() {
@Override
public ACTION onAsyncReplicationError(Throwable iException, int iRetry) {
return iException instanceof ONeedRetryException && iRetry<=3 ? ACTION.RETRY : ACTION.IGNORE;
}
})).execute();
} finally {
g.shutdown();
}
}
Thread.sleep(1000);
// CHECK VERTEX CREATION ON ALL THE SERVERS
for (int s = 0; s<SERVERS; ++s) {
OrientGraphFactory factory2 = new OrientGraphFactory("plocal:target/server" + s + "/databases/" + getDatabaseName());
OrientGraphNoTx g2 = factory2.getNoTx();
try {
Iterable<OrientVertex> result = g2.command(new OCommandSQL("select from Own")).execute();
Assert.assertTrue(result.iterator().hasNext());
Assert.assertNotNull(result.iterator().next());
result = g2.command(new OCommandSQL("select from Post")).execute();
Assert.assertTrue(result.iterator().hasNext());
final OrientVertex v = result.iterator().next();
Assert.assertNotNull(v);
final Iterable<Edge> inEdges = v.getEdges(Direction.IN);
Assert.assertTrue(inEdges.iterator().hasNext());
Assert.assertNotNull(inEdges.iterator().next());
result = g2.command(new OCommandSQL("select from User")).execute();
Assert.assertTrue(result.iterator().hasNext());
final OrientVertex v2 = result.iterator().next();
Assert.assertNotNull(v2);
final Iterable<Edge> outEdges = v2.getEdges(Direction.OUT);
Assert.assertTrue(outEdges.iterator().hasNext());
Assert.assertNotNull(outEdges.iterator().next());
} finally {
g2.shutdown();
}
}
}
}
